Avv. Elaine Degiorgio
Elaine Degiorgio was admitted to the bar in the 2018, having attained a Masters of Advocacy from the University of Malta, preceded by successful qualifications in a Bachelors of Law (Honours). Her undergraduate thesis titled ‘Criminalising Revenge Porn’, which mainly brought to light the new emerging technological crimes due to globalisation of society especially through the high use of technology, eventually led to an amendment to the Criminal Code to address specifically revenge pornography.
Elaine practices primarily in Civil Law, with a focus on Family Law, Property and Rent Law and Employment Law. She also has an interest in Human Rights Law.
